By default, the categories are positioned stacked on top of each other. If you want to compare more than one distribution, you can set the position argument of geom_histogram() to “dodge” to put the bars for each group next to each other instead of stacking them. However, this can look confusing with several categories.

WebDodge overlapping objects side-to-side Description. Dodging preserves the vertical position of an geom while adjusting the horizontal position. position_dodge() requires the grouping variable to be be specified in the global or ⁠geom_*⁠ layer.
